Verse 3
Job 39:3. They bow themselves Being taught by a divine instinct to put themselves into such a posture as may be most fit for their safe and easy bringing forth. They bring forth their young ones Hebrew, תפלחנה , tephallachnah, dissecant, discindunt, scilicet matricem, aut ventrem ad pullos edendos. Buxdorf. They tear, or rend, themselves asunder to bring forth their young. The word is used, Proverbs 7:23, of a dart striking through and dividing the liver, and may here be considered as signifying, that the wild goats and hinds bring forth their young with as much pain as if a dart pierced them through. They cast out their sorrows Partus suos, their births; LXX., ωδινας αυτων , the pains, or sorrows, of bringing forth; that is, their young ones and their sorrows together.
